Why corrosion-resistant pipe fittings are an indispensable part of industrial pipeline systems

In modern industrial production, pipeline systems are core facilities to ensure the smooth transportation of raw materials and the production process. Especially in the chemical, petroleum, natural gas and other industries, pipeline systems not only have to withstand extreme environments such as high temperature and high pressure, but also often need to contact with corrosive chemicals, liquids or gases. Since the pipeline system is exposed to these harsh conditions for a long time, if non-corrosion-resistant pipe fittings are used, problems such as pipeline rupture and leakage are prone to occur, which seriously affect production safety and work efficiency. Therefore, Corrosion Resistant Tube Fittings have become an indispensable key component in industrial pipeline systems.

The role of the pipeline system in industrial production is self-evident. It is the main channel for the transportation of raw materials, products, gases or liquids. For industries such as chemical, petroleum and natural gas, pipelines not only need to withstand extreme conditions such as high temperature and high pressure, but more often they will be exposed to highly corrosive chemicals, acid and alkali solutions, etc. If the pipe fittings of the pipeline system do not have sufficient corrosion resistance, once corrosion occurs, it will not only cause raw material leakage and increase production losses, but may also cause safety accidents such as fire and explosion, and even endanger the lives of personnel.

Anti-corrosion pipe fittings use materials with strong corrosion resistance such as stainless steel, titanium alloy, polytetrafluoroethylene, etc., which can still maintain the stability, strength and sealing of the pipeline when exposed to corrosive media for a long time, thereby effectively preventing pipeline leakage and rupture. This not only reduces the risk of accidents, but also improves the safety of the entire industrial pipeline system and ensures the smooth progress of the production process.
